High-Protein Greek Yogurt Pancakes with Berries

Ingredients
4
Person(s)
  • 1 cup
    Plain Greek yogurt
  • 2 large
    Egg
  • 1 cup
    Oat flour
  • 1 tsp
    Baking Powder
  • 1 tsp
    Vanilla Extract
  • 1 tbsp
    Honey or maple syrup
  • 1/4 tsp
    Salt
  • 1 tbsp
    Milk
  • 1 tsp
    Butter or cooking spray for the skillet
  • 1 cup
    Mixed berries
Directions
  • Make the Batter

    In a large mixing bowl, whisk together the Greek yogurt, eggs, vanilla extract, and honey until smooth. Add the oat flour, baking powder, and salt. Stir just until combined. If the batter feels too thick, mix in the milk one tablespoon at a time until it reaches a thick but pourable consistency. Let the batter rest for 5 minutes.

  • Heat the Skillet

    Place a nonstick skillet or griddle over medium heat. Lightly grease it with butter or cooking spray. Once hot, scoop about ¼ cup of batter onto the skillet for each pancake, leaving space between them.

  • Cook the Pancakes

    Cook for 2–3 minutes, or until bubbles begin to form on the surface and the edges look set. Flip carefully and cook for another 2–3 minutes until both sides are golden brown and the centers are fully cooked. Repeat with the remaining batter.

  • Add the Berries & Serve

    Stack the warm pancakes on serving plates and top with fresh mixed berries. Add a dollop of Greek yogurt and drizzle with maple syrup if desired. Serve immediately while warm.
